/// <summary> /// Verifica se a consulta existe no Database antes de deleta-lo. /// </summary> /// <param name="id">Usado para buscar a consulta no Database.</param> public void Deletar(int id) { var obj = _consultaRepositorio.SelecionarPorId(id); if (obj == null) { throw new NaoEncontradoException($"O ID: \"{id}\" não foi encontrado!"); } _consultaRepositorio.Deletar(id); }
public void Deveria_deletar_uma_consulta() { //Preparação var consultaDeletada = _contextoTeste.Consultas.Find(1); //Ação _repositorio.Deletar(consultaDeletada); //Afirmar var todasConsultas = _contextoTeste.Consultas.ToList(); Assert.AreEqual(1, todasConsultas.Count); }
/// <summary> /// /// </summary> /// <param name="id"></param> public void Deletar(int id) { var obj = SelecionarPorId(id); _consultaRepositorio.Deletar(obj.Id); }
public void Deletar(int id) { repositorio.Deletar(id); }